Lactated Ringer's
A solution used in intravenous therapy for fluid and electrolyte replenishment, containing sodium, chloride, potassium, calcium, and lactate.
Chemical Splash Injury
An injury caused by the exposure of skin or eyes to hazardous chemicals in liquid form, often requiring immediate medical attention.
Irrigation Fluid
A sterile solution used to cleanse or flush a body part, typically during medical procedures to remove debris or bacteria.
Visual Acuity
A measure of the sharpness or clarity of visual perception, often tested with a Snellen chart.
